My wife and I considered several cruise lines before we settled on Tauck. We are looking for the best river cruise for our family — three of us, including our twelve-year-old — and while the Adventures By Disney option was tempting, we really liked Tauck's itinerary. The reviews were consistently high, and the agent we spoke with was extremely helpful and knowledgable.

We boarded the MS Savor in Budapest. Members of the crew and the cruise director greeted us, all cheery and welcoming. We quickly discovered the Panorama Lounge and had a light lunch as we waited for our cabin to be ready. From those first moments, we were very impressed. We had never been aboard a river boat, and we weren't sure what to expect. I think our biggest fear was cramped quarters and packed dining halls — far from it. MS Savor is a big roomy vessel that was spit-spot clean for the entire journey.

Our cabin was much bigger than we had imagined. We were on the uppermost deck about halfway down from reception. With the exception of a few kids who ran along the hallway from time to time, it was very quiet.
